SHOPPING:
The best shop is a little kids' design
headquarters called Genius Jones (49 NE 39th St.). And of
course, I must plug our magical playground at Aventura
Mall (19501 Biscayne Blvd.) called Rainbow Valley
as one of the most magical spots in town. If you make the drive north
and you are a nerdy kinda comic lover like me, then go to Tate's
Comics (4566 N. University Dr., Lauderhill). I don't care if you
think that it's stupid.
ART:
Best gallery in town is Emmanuel
Perrotin (194 NW 30th St.). They show Murakami, Mr., Gelitin and
some of our local favorites. I think they really rock it out so nicely.
